Grilled Zucchini

Total Time Prep/Total Time: 20 min.
Yield 4 servings
Set aside some room on the grill for zucchini. This side cooks quickly, and grilled zucchini pairs well with everything from barbecued chicken to tropical pork skewers.

Ingredients

  • 6 small zucchini, halved lengthwise
  • 4 teaspoons olive oil, divided
  • 2 green onions, thinly sliced
  • 2 tablespoons lemon juice
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/8 teaspoon crushed red pepper flakes

Directions

  1. Drizzle zucchini with 2 teaspoons oil. Grill, covered, over medium heat for 8-10 minutes or until tender, turning once.
  2. Place in a large bowl. Add the green onions, lemon juice, salt, pepper flakes and remaining oil; toss to coat.

Nutrition Facts

3 zucchini halves: 73 calories, 5g fat (1g saturated fat), 0 cholesterol, 314mg sodium, 7g carbohydrate (3g sugars, 2g fiber), 2g protein. Diabetic Exchanges: 1 vegetable, 1 fat.
